Tetra Pak Thailand Awarded Top Green Company In Asia

2014-11-27 14:29 3589

BANGKOK, Nov. 27,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Tetra Pak (Thailand) Limited was recognized as one of the Top Green Companies in Asia at the Asia Corporate Excellence & Sustainability Awards (ACES) 2014 organised by MORS Group.

Tetra Pak Thailand, one of the top market companies of Tetra Pak®, the world leader in food processing and packaging solutions, has won at the Asia Corporate Excellence & Sustainability Awards 2014 (ACES) under the Sustainability category at an award ceremony organised at the Fairmont Singapore on November 26, 2014, along with three other companies from Hong Kong, India, and the Philippines.

"We are pleased and honoured to be recognised for our sustainability commitment through our social and environmental initiatives, in particular our Green Roof Project for Princess Pa Foundation. As a leading food processing and packaging company, we consider the full value chain as our approach to sustainability and the environment, starting from our suppliers and continuing with our production processes and of course end of life. We work with our customers and various stakeholders to protect the environment by using paper which is a renewable material as our main material, developing carton collection and recycling systems, and promoting the benefits of sustainability to consumers," said Mr. Henrik Hauggaard, Managing Director, Tetra Pak (Thailand) Limited.

"Our CSR activities have been developed based on our motto, "PROTECTS WHAT'S GOOD™", along the dimensions of our brand pillars: Food, People and Futures. Among others, the Green Roof Project for Princess Pa Foundation, which calls for public participation to send consumed cartons to be recycled into roof sheets for those in need through the Princess Pa Foundation, the Thai Red Cross Society, is a perfect example of how we can extend the meaning of protection beyond food safety to also embrace our employees, the communities in which we operate, the environment as well as our customers business -- so they too feel protected with Tetra Pak," he added.

The Top Green Companies in Asia Award is awarded to companies that run their business operations yielding minimal negative impact on the environment, community, and society. The winning companies undertake environmentally friendly activities at all facets of the organization to ensure that its processes, products, and production activities adequately address current environmental concerns while maintaining long term profitability.

ABOUT TETRA PAK

Tetra Pak is the world's leading food processing and packaging solutions company. Working closely with our customers and suppliers, we provide safe, innovative and environmentally sound products that each day meet the needs of hundreds of millions of people in more than 170 countries around the world.  With almost 23,000 employees based in over 85 countries, we believe in responsible industry leadership and a sustainable approach to business. Our motto, "PROTECTS WHAT'S GOOD™," reflects our vision to make food safe and available, everywhere.
